I'd try the 10mm torx socket first, it that doesn't work, drill it and use an easy out. It would be nice if you don't need to drill all the way thru the drain plug, but if you do, catch the first cup and discard, then catch the rest of the oil.
I was gonna suggest pulling the pan completely before you drill, but that would be just incredibly messy.
I always use a brand new, high quality drill for drilling and extracting. Done a few in the past year.

If I was drilling and therefore getting metal fragments in the oil, I would replace ALL of the oil. I wouldn't rick possible engine damage for less than $100 of oil, Hell if you get M1 at wallyworld, its $50 for 10 quatrts
